23 Marcel Avenue, Randwick

Ramona Hall, A Lovingly Revived Spanish Mission Style Block Of Five Offered For Sale In One Line

Unique to the market, Ramona Hall is a boutique block of semi-sized apartments built in 1927 and standing proud as one of Sydney's finest examples of Spanish Mission architecture with design cues reminiscent of Neville Hampson's iconic Boomerang. A meticulous renovation in keeping with the building's heritage pedigree has transformed this landmark block into an exclusive collection of beautifully appointed designer apartments in one of Sydney's most desirable beach village neighbourhoods. Wide entry halls, high ornate ceilings and leadlight windows pay homage to the past while an imaginative redesign captures the essence of contemporary coastal style with each two bedroom apartment featuring a private verandah or courtyard. Tucked away in a leafy enclave just behind Clovelly Road's village hub, Ramona Hall is walking distance to Clovelly and Coogee Beaches, Gordons Bay, the famed coast walk and renowned schools. High rental demand and a strong income stream makes this blue-chip property a standout home plus income opportunity or low-maintenance portfolio addition for the investor or SMSF buyer.
